Technolog Here we go. Starting a first week of my second grow.
Sativa dominant Durban Poison from Dutch Passion looks like a perfect fit for long winter evenings.
Lets our journey to begin.
I took two seeds and placed them into the plastic box with 99% humidity and extremely highly moisturised environment.
Reduced the amount of moisture and lowered humidity to 80% when seeds cracked and showed their tails.
Autumn nights are cold this year so seeds need stable temperature environment. Placed them near the electric heater (40 °C / 104 °F) on some distance and put a towel underneath to isolate environment and reduce temperature losses.
Day 1 (14/10/20) - seeds planted.
Decided to plant directly to the big soil. One seed didn't threw it's cask so planted it on some small distance under the top soil. Another one was fully opened but smaller, so decided to place the first leaves above the ground and put the root under, hope it will survive and use this hard period as a life lesson and become stronger :)
Watering - 100ml of water with Ionic CalMag (0.3ml/1l).
Day 2 (15/10/20) - seeds showed up.
Watering - 100ml of water with Ionic CalMag (0.3ml/1l).

Technolog This week was quite interesting. We can see a good growth dynamics and plant development due to the strong genetics. Also, now I have a valuable knowledge about the connection between water temp and nutrient absorption. I applied new technics in nutrient feeding. Now measuring them by concentration in the water volume PPM, instead of measuring on scales. It appears to be much easier and you will not make a mistake if you need to create several portions of solution in different volumes.
